The special education lesson plans must reflect state and federal instructional standards, meet IEP goals and bring congruence between assessment and instructional procedures. Review Megan Coyle's photo collage series where students will learn to identify different landmarks of cities. Teaching Guide: Writing Lesson Plans. In most cases the special education lessons are developed within a high structured framework that allows for individualized adjustments based on the student's responses. The 4 key components are: 1) Setting your objectives; 2) Determining your standards for the students' performance; 3) Thinking of ways to get the students' attention; and 4) Finding ways to present the lesson.
